I could write about how sad things were, how dark the days had become, how painful getting up was. How much we missed Basti. Instead I will write about how smiles are slowly replacing tears, how a bounce has returned to our steps. How Bogart has silently and gently uplifted us all. Bogart is a 5 month old Australian short-legged Jack Russel terrier. He is a bundle of energy to say the least. He just runs and jumps and double jumps, even bumping his head under the car as he jumps, he doesn't care, probably doesn't bother him. He just plays and plays and plays. You can't help but smile. He will bite at your hand, jump on your back and chew your shirt, interfere with anything your doing or attempting to do. But when you hold him, he lays still, just being there. It's like a switch. People still accidentally call him Basti, its a testament to how much Basti was loved. Bogart wasn't always Bogart, the people we bought him from called him Mozart, then Leslie called him Sparky, but her dad named him Bogart and that was that. For a time her mum called him Borgy, now she's calling him Bogart. So I guess he's pretty confused, I know I was.
All in all things are picking up. It hasn't been a great month for us but we're still here. The trials, the waiting, the helplessness, the uncertainty. I guess its all part of growing up. And growing up is something we all have to go through at one point or another. Whether it be an exam you studied so hard for and failed, or a game you worked so hard for and didn't win, or someone you loved so much and lost. It doesn't matter how trivial, but that also goes for your triumphs. It doesn't matter if you just barely passed that exam, or you got lucky during that game you should've lost, or getting a puppy. What matters is you did it and you're happy. We still don't know where our place in the sun is, but we know its out there somewhere. We just have to look harder.
Just when you thought you were done growing up, you surprise yourself and grow up just a little bit more.

In memory of Sebastian... he loved drinking out of the garden hose.
